What You Bring:

We're looking for someone who combines industry expertise with strong leadership and analytical capabilities:

  • In-depth knowledge of airline revenue accounting (ticketing, ancillary revenue, refunds, interline, etc.).

  • Familiarity with aviation accounting standards, including IATA Revenue Accounting guidelines.

  • Experience with complex revenue recognition and compliance requirements.

  • Strong ability to analyse large data sets and identify trends, discrepancies, and improvement opportunities.

  • Confidence in forecasting, budgeting, and variance analysis.

  • A continuous improvement mindset with a passion for process optimization and automation.

  • Experience working with technology teams on system implementations and upgrades.

  • Proven leadership skills with the ability to inspire, delegate, and build a positive team culture.

  • Strong fluency in spoken and written English, with the ability to clearly communicate complex financial information.

  • Strong problem-solving skills backed by analytical thinking and accuracy.

  • Exceptional attention to detail and commitment to delivering error-free financial results.
